1/9/2014 10:03:40 SocialNewsDesk

SND was created by a couple of news people. They say over 500newsrooms use it now. It has features that you won't find in other similartools that only would be useful in a newsroom like reminding you to post,spell check, add a link, etc - best practice stuff. And you can put yourwhole team on it ... so everyone gets their own login and we don't haveto passwords for the native platforms anymore. It has a nice analyticsreport too ... you can get it emailed like overnights so you get a quick at aglance update daily. We also run all of our Facebook contests through it. Paid Yes Medium

1/9/2014 10:06:40 Spredfast

Lots of analytics to dig into (if you have the time :) and also features ascheduling tool. You can add multiple users without having to make themadmins of your account. Facebook, Twitter, Google+. Facebook hasadded many of the scheduling features that Spredfast has before, suchas the ability to edit scheduled post, upload your own thumbnails, etc. We have an account through Gannett's enterprise agreement, so I'm notsure about the cost. 1/9/2014 13:31:47 Visual Revenue/Outbrain

My favorite part of this tool is the real-time click through rate informationfor our home page. It has definitely opened our eyes about how peopleinteract with our stories, the home page carousel, etc. Although most ofthe tool isn't social per se, it does include A/B headline testing tool, whichwould be as useful for tweets as for headlines. It also include a fairly in-depth "social" tab, which can track clicks per hour and something it terms"reach" (both for Facebook and Twitter accounts). I also tracks somementions. Theoretically, you can schedule tweets, etc., but we don't usethe tool for that. Paid No Medium

1/9/2014 13:35:37 Bitly Enterprise

We just added bitly enterprise in November. This offers all kinds ofTwitter/sharing coolness to our site. It allows all our social shares to goout with our branded strib.mn short URL. There is extensive tracking,hourly, daily, etc, most shared. It shows us what OTHERS are sharingvia bitly. We can edit the unique part of short urls, for example: strib.mn/jmorneau, etc. You can also point the same URL to a new webaddress. It gives us referral data on our stories shared via bitly. (The listkind of goes on and on). It is not cheap Paid Yes Medium

1/9/2014 14:11:18 Bitly (Free)

Before we got Bitly Enterprise, we really relied on the free version of bitly.Because we had a grandfathered API code, were were actually able touse our branded short URL through TweetDeck Bitly log-in (although Ibelieve this has been taken away now) Nevertheless, even the freeversion of bitly allows users to track clicks on story shares. I *think* it stillallows you to edit the unique part of a short URL here bit.ly/*editable. Youcan also do some basic tracking of shares over time, days, geography,referrers Totally free No Medium

1/9/2014 17:25:40 Buffer

Really easy tool for scheduling posts to different platforms. The queue feature also lets you add tweets (from browser or readingapp) and will send them out on a pre-chosen schedule. The pay features are improving all the time, they have more robust stuff(including more analytics) for business prices.

Basic service is free, butyou pay for premiumfeatures No Medium

1/9/2014 22:02:53 Crowdtangle

It adds context to FB posts by creating a score for every entry -- if a pagetypically gets 20 likes on every entry, a post with 40 likes gets a score of2x. This allows you to see what is trending. You can also use their searchfunctions to surface local stories with broader potential. Good for keepingtrack of competitors. Paid No Large

1/14/2014 10:32:10 ThinkUp

Allows us to freely aggregate, store and search brand and reporterTweets (as well as other social media postings). It leverages an OpenSource code base. It can be self-hosted. It allows us to see patterns andsignificant events in our social media. Totally free Yes Medium

1/14/2014 10:33:44 YOURLS

Self-hosted link-shortner. Gives us full control over our links. Providestracking, can be modified to output an RSS feed of shortened links.Open-source. Easy to use. Totally free Yes Medium
